- Premier Retina Only Practice in NY Seeks VR Surgeon; quick path to partnership!
Description
Vitreoretinal Consultants of New York (VRCNY), a premier retina only group, is seeking a board certified/board eligible, fellowship trained Vitreoretinal Surgeon, due to substantial growth. This position would be based in our Queens and Long Island locations and would offer the opportunity to practice with established physicians in areas with an excellent, well-established referral base.
Founded in 1981, our team of 20 nationally-recognized Vitreoretinal Surgeons have established themselves as distinguished physicians, compassionate providers, and key thought leaders in the local and national retina care community. Together, we have grown the practice to include 10 well-equipped offices and a research center with multiple locations stretching from Rockland County to Riverhead.
The practice continues to experience significant growth with expansion in clinical research and new office locations throughout its coverage area.

Your practice would be highly engaging medically and surgically, and you would enjoy:
- $400k guaranteed salary year one, $500k guaranteed salary year two, and $600k guaranteed salary year three as an associate. Three year path to partnership (no buy in or loans to pay); significant compensation increase once physician makes partner
- Generous sign-on bonus, relocation assistance, 3rd year lucrative pre-partner bonus incentive, and profit interests granted on day one of employment
- Full benefits including company paid health and dental insurance
- 401k
- Company funded licensing, dues, subscriptions, and generous CME
- Paid time off and holidays
- Fully funded malpractice

Requirements
Candidate Requirements:
- Graduate of accredited medical school
- Residency in Ophthalmology
- Fellowship in Vitreoretinal Surgery
- Board certified/board eligible in Ophthalmology
- State licensed in New York or eligible to become state licensed in New York
- Bilingual in Spanish, Mandarin, and/or Korean a plus
